Austin Riesenberger built SWERV's first five ERV units for $2,000 total, then turned down a Hawaii relocation to keep the company.
Austin Riesenberger is the Founder of SWERV, a clean technology company focused on clean air innovation. A mechanical engineer and physicist by training, Austin studied at Colia and developed an early curiosity for how things work, one that eventually drove him toward building solutions at the intersection of engineering and environmental impact. SWERV is working to address air quality challenges through hardware and technology developed at Greentown Labs, one of the leading clean tech incubators in the country.
Austin joined Blake on The Grove, a podcast by Earth Onward, to walk through his entrepreneurial journey and share what SWERV is building in the clean air space. The conversation covered his background in mechanical engineering, the path from tinkering with machines as a kid to founding a company tackling a real environmental problem, and the specifics of the product SWERV is developing. Austin offered an honest look at what it takes to build in clean tech, the role of community and support networks in that process, and where he sees the opportunity for meaningful progress on air quality. His episode is part of The Grove's ongoing series featuring founders and innovators working on some of the most pressing challenges in clean technology today.
